RE: anacron jobs for users



On 11-Jan-2000 Philip Lehman wrote:
> 
> Is there a way to set up anacron jobs as a non-root user? There
> doesn't seem to be an equivalent to the user crontab files and I
> couldn't find any other obvious solution.
> 
> I have this small backup script for parts of my home directory and I
> want it to run as a daily job. The box is a laptop so cron jobs are
> not quite the way to go, but I'm sure there's a better way than
> putting "sudo -u username myscript" in the system-wide anacrontab?
> 

no, it is only a system tool.  Consider an at job from your login script.
